Sheffield Wednesday vs Charlton Preview: Owls Fighting for Survival as Addicks Eye Top Half Push

It's matchday. Sheffield Wednesday host Charlton at Hillsborough on Saturday 18 April 2026 and honestly, the stakes could not be higher for the Owls. Here's everything you need to know before kick-off.

Last updated: Saturday 18 April 2026, match day. Right, this is it. The big one. Well, every game is the big one when you're Sheffield Wednesday right now. Sitting 24th in the Championship, 25 goals scored, 82 conceded... mate, those numbers are genuinely difficult to look at. Charlton roll into Hillsborough sitting 18th, and while they're not setting the world alight either, they've got 39 goals to their name this season. Nearly double what Wednesday have managed. This is going to be a day.

Where Wednesday Are Right Now

Look, I'm not going to sugarcoat it. A goals-against column of 82 is the kind of number that keeps a manager up at night. That's not just a soft defence, that is a defence that has had an absolute nightmare of a season. And 25 goals scored at the other end means Wednesday haven't been causing many problems going forward either. The maths is brutal. The Owls are in real, genuine trouble.

Hillsborough should be rocking today though. Look at the fixtures and you'll see Wednesday are running out of chances to turn this around. The home crowd know it. When a stadium like Hillsborough gets behind a team with everything on the line... honestly, that atmosphere can do things that tactics can't. I've been in grounds where the fans dragged teams over the line through pure noise. Today has to be one of those days for the Owls faithful.

Charlton: Don't Sleep on the Addicks

Charlton are 18th. Comfortable enough not to be panicking, not high enough to be celebrating. But look at that goals scored column. 39 goals. That is a side that has shown it can find the net. Compared to Wednesday's 82 conceded... you do the maths. Or rather, don't. It's too depressing if you're an Owls fan.

The away side will fancy this. They're coming to a ground where the home team is desperate, which can work both ways. Sometimes desperation drives a team to dig out a result. Other times, the pressure gets to them and the visitors nick it on the counter. Charlton have the firepower to punish any mistakes at the back, and Sheffield Wednesday have been making plenty of those this season.

Honestly, if you're a neutral, Charlton are in a decent enough position to go and enjoy themselves today. No real pressure on them. Just turn up, play their game, and see what happens. That kind of freedom can be dangerous.
